Transaction 62bafd86b8448e2064f79bd99e6a85e4ec4973d86390140aaee9cdeb61869a2f

1 Input
2 Outputs
  • 62bafd86b8448e2064f79bd99e6a85e4ec4973d86390140aaee9cdeb61869a2f:0
  • value  2444000
    address  36mREXpCzgKUBWahySX2Wg6pC7KFW4xcg3
  • 62bafd86b8448e2064f79bd99e6a85e4ec4973d86390140aaee9cdeb61869a2f:1
  • value  55252467
    address  1Kwt3tuafLuFhnQcacR451Ntqk4A9xZRRb